  • Strawberries (fresh or frozen): The main ingredient that gives natural sweetness and fruity flavor.
  • Milk or plant-based milk: Helps everything blend smoothly while adding a creamy texture.
  • Yogurt (optional): Adds thickness, richness, and extra protein.
  • Honey or maple syrup (optional): Provides gentle sweetness if needed.
  • Chia seeds or flaxseeds (optional): Boost fiber and add nutritional value.
  • Ice (optional): Helps the smoothie stay cold and a little thicker.

  • Dairy-Free Options: Replace dairy milk with almond, soy, oat, or coconut milk. They help maintain a creamy texture while remaining lactose-free.
  • Vegan-Friendly Alternatives- Choose plant-based yogurt or leave it out, then add seeds or nut butter for protein and richness without animal products.
  • High-Protein and High-Fiber Add-Ins: Protein powder, Greek-style plant yogurt, hemp seeds, or peanut butter boost satiety. Oats and chia seeds add fiber to support digestion and keep you full.
  • Low-Calorie Ingredient Swaps: Use unsweetened almond milk and leave out added sweeteners. Add ice or extra strawberries for volume without added calories.

A Healthy Strawberry Smoothie tastes best when small details are done right. These tips help improve flavor, texture, and consistency.

  1. Choose Ripe Strawberries: Fully ripe strawberries bring natural sweetness and a pleasant aroma. They reduce the need for extra sweeteners and improve overall flavor. Using ripe fruit makes a Healthy Strawberry Smoothie taste fresher and more vibrant.
  1. Adjust Sweetness Naturally: Always taste the smoothie before adding sweeteners. If it needs sweetness, use natural options like dates or bananas instead of sugar. This helps keep the taste mild, balanced, and natural.
  1. Control Thickness and Consistency: Using frozen strawberries adds creaminess, while fresh strawberries give a lighter texture. Add liquid slowly and in small amounts. This helps avoid a watery smoothie and keeps the texture just right.
  1. Blend in Stages: Blend slowly at first, then raise the speed. This helps break down fruit evenly and prevents chunks. A gradual blend gives the Healthy Strawberry Smoothie a smooth and creamy finish.
  1. Serve Immediately: Freshly blended smoothies have the best taste and nutrition. Sitting for a while can alter the texture and flavour. Enjoy it right away for the most refreshing experience.
  1. Use a Cold Liquid Base: Cold milk or chilled plant-based drinks keep the smoothie refreshing. It also helps maintain thickness without needing extra ice. This improves both taste and texture.
  1. Do Not Overblend: Blending too long can make the smoothie thin and foamy. Stop once everything looks smooth and well combined. Short blending keeps the texture pleasant.
  1. Clean the Blender Right Away: Rinsing the blender immediately keeps residue from sticking. It also saves time later and keeps flavors fresh for your next smoothie. Clean tools make every blend better.

  • A freshly made smoothie tastes best right away. Properly sealed, it keeps fresh in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ours. A Healthy Strawberry Smoothie may separate slightly, so shake before drinking.
  • Prepare freezer packs with strawberries and add-ins. Store them in freezer bags. When ready, blend with liquid for quick preparation.
  • Use airtight glass jars or BPA-free bottles. They help protect the taste while blocking unwanted smells.

Is a strawberry smoothie healthy every day?

Yes, when made with whole ingredients and no refined sugar, it can be enjoyed daily. Balance it with protein and fiber for the best results.

Can I use frozen strawberries instead of fresh?

Absolutely. Using frozen strawberries helps create a thick, chilled smoothie without the need for ice.

Is a strawberry smoothie good for weight loss?

It can be a good option. Use unsweetened liquids, portion carefully, and add protein or fiber for lasting fullness.

Can kids drink strawberry smoothies?

Yes. They are kid-friendly and a great way to include fruit and nutrients in a fun form.

What liquid is best for strawberry smoothies?

You can use milk, almond milk, oat milk, or coconut water. Choose based on taste and dietary needs.

How do I make my smoothie thicker?

Use frozen fruit, yogurt, oats, or reduce the liquid slightly for a thicker texture.

Can I make a strawberry smoothie without a blender?

A blender is best, but a powerful immersion blender can work for softer ingredients.

This Healthy Strawberry Smoothie is fresh, creamy, and naturally sweet. It is made with simple ingredients and comes together in minutes. Perfect for breakfast, snacks, or a light meal.
Prep Time 5 minutes
Total Time 5 minutes
Course Breakfast, Snack
Cuisine American
Servings 2 Small Servings
Calories 160 kcal

Ingredients
  

• 1 cup strawberries (fresh or frozen)

• 1 cup milk or any plant-based milk

• ¼ cup yogurt (optional)

• 1–2 teaspoons honey or maple syrup (optional)

• 1 teaspoon chia seeds or flaxseeds (optional)

• 4–5 ice cubes (optional)

Instructions
 

1. Add the liquid to the blender.

    2. Add strawberries and any optional ingredients.

      3. Blend until smooth and creamy.

        4. Adjust the thickness with liquid or ice.

          5. Pour into a glass and serve immediately.

            Notes

            • Use ripe strawberries for natural sweetness.
            • Frozen strawberries create a thicker smoothie.
            • Taste before adding sweeteners.
            • Add protein for a filling meal.
            • Adjust the liquid slowly for the best texture.
            • Drink fresh for the best flavor and nutrition.
            • Customize add-ins based on dietary needs.
